Transaction 62cacea59b9969dd660e94f876bf2e595e9810e5e2c19692f9493c8364377b40

1 Input
2 Outputs
  • 62cacea59b9969dd660e94f876bf2e595e9810e5e2c19692f9493c8364377b40:0
  • value  69140000
    address  1P5LbGkycLZ3Pt32hVErPEmtUF4kfxM3Eh
  • 62cacea59b9969dd660e94f876bf2e595e9810e5e2c19692f9493c8364377b40:1
  • value  622371346
    address  1PmiVhxkVcstUEysVKs7NtY8AUWvBCi22K